38

有谁知道任何好的NASM或 FASM 教程?我正在尝试学习汇编程序,但似乎找不到任何好的资源。

4

5 回答 5

31

例如,使用 NASM 编写有用的程序,当然还有显而易见的http://www.nasm.us/doc/nasmdoc3.html

在http://www.csee.umbc.edu/help/nasm/sample.shtml有几个示例程序

如果您正在寻找关于汇编编程的更一般性的介绍,请参阅The Art of Assembly Programming和 NASM 上的维基百科页面,参考Jeff Duntemann的Assembly Language Step by Step 。

于 2009-12-22T15:35:19.080 回答
18

Paul Carter 博士有一本关于汇编语言的免费书籍。它基于 NASM。 http://www.drpaulcarter.com/pcasm/

有一些有趣的示例程序集合在

于 2010-02-04T14:05:47.900 回答
7

FASM

这不是教程,但非常有帮助:

http://flatassembler.net/docs.php?article=manual

还可以考虑查看该语言附带的示例。

还有一个包含大量信息的论坛(关于各种主题)

http://board.flatassembler.net/index.php

这是初学者常见问题解答,其中包含初学者的所有相关信息:

http://board.flatassembler.net/topic.php?t=2530

于 2010-07-17T17:05:00.073 回答
2

我也在学习,前几天才发现。

汇编语言编程的艺术

我还没有全部读完,但我已经使用了它的一部分。

于 2011-05-16T00:24:23.250 回答
1

对于 Windows 教程,这些是我所知道的最好的: http ://win32assembly.programminghorizo​​n.com/tutorials.html

在这个 fasm 论坛帖子中也翻译成 fasm 语法: http ://board.flatassembler.net/topic.php?t=2158

于 2012-02-03T23:34:25.787 回答